How to Maintain a Robot Cleaner
A robot vacuums that mop cleaner is a device that cleans or mops the floor automatically. It is usually battery operated and is equipped with sensors to stay clear of walls and furniture. It is also designed to return to its base when its dust bin is empty or it needs to recharge.
Certain models come with zones or spots that are cleaned in mode. You can choose an area by using the app or voice commands.
Self-emptying Dustbin
With a self-emptying bin, you can run your robot cleaners more often without worrying about debris. This will help keep your floors cleaner and reduce the amount of allergens present in the air. Most robot vacuums have a clear bin onboard however, this can be difficult to clean and can be a nuisance for those who suffer from allergies or do not like touching dirt. Self-emptying models will have an empty bag that you simply empty into a trash container or garbage bag, so you don't need to touch it.
Self-emptying models can be a bit expensive, but in the end, they'll save you money. You'll have to purchase replacement bags for them, but they typically contain a month's worth of dirt and other squander, so you'll have to empty them less often than non-self-emptying models. They could also contain HEPA filters, and can recycle the contents in an environmentally ecological way.
Another advantage of a self-emptying robot vacuum is the ability to set it to clean when you're away from home. This feature can be found on the majority of robots and can be easily scheduled using an app on your smartphone or tablet. Some brands offer multiple settings for cleaning different areas of the home. You can even set specific times to clean an area or room.
If you choose to opt for a self-emptying robot vacuum, you'll need an appropriate docking station that can support the weight of the machine and hold the huge waste container. It should also have a place to store the brand's floor-cleaning solution that it mixes with water and dispenses when you mow.
Be aware that emptying the bin is a noisy process. The base is used to collect the debris from vacuuming until it's full, and then it releases it into a larger container. The sound can last up to a minute, and could be louder than the vacuum itself. Some models have a DND mode and you can switch it on to make the process quieter.
Easy to maintain
Robot vacuum cleaners are an excellent addition to your arsenal of cleaning tools because they are convenient and efficient. However, they can also require some care to keep them in tip-top shape. This includes emptying the trash bin frequently, checking the brushes for hair tangles and wiping sensors or cameras. Fortunately, these tasks are not difficult to accomplish and should take just a few minutes.
The robot vacuum must be kept in a place that is clean and dry, free from any water hazards or spills. These liquids could damage the robot's electronics and reduce its lifespan. If a robot vacuum comes in contact with any liquids, it should be turned off immediately and cleaned thoroughly prior to beginning a new cleaning session.
You can also maintain your robot vacuum by following the cleaning and maintenance instructions that are provided by the manufacturer. These instructions can be found in the user's manual or in the app. Most manufacturers recommend cleaning the filters and emptying the trash bin and cleaning the wheel, sensors and brush. Maintaining these components in good order will prevent debris from building up within the vacuum's motor and clogging its filter.
If your robot vacuum has self-emptying bases it will empty the dirt after each cleaning job and avoid overflowing. These bases have a large water tank that can be used for multiple cleaning sessions, which saves time and effort. However, these models tend to be louder than their counterparts and are best robotic mop and vacuum for those who live in smaller homes.
Robot vacuums can be programmed to skip specific areas of the home or to clean them after a certain time. They can be programmed to stop or slow in corners and other tight areas. These programs can be made easily with an app and are useful.
Some of the top robot cleaners come with wall and wheel sensors to improve their navigation systems. These sensors let them steer clear of obstacles and walls without hitting them or scratching the surface. They also provide information about the kind of floor they are cleaning and the corners. This helps the robotic cleaner to make better decisions and reduces the chance of accidents and confusion.

Most robot cleaners are equipped with sensors that allow them to navigate around obstacles. For example, some models have LiDAR-based navigation systems which use laser scanners to map out the surroundings. This technology helps the robot avoid bumping into furniture, ensuring that all areas are maintained effectively. Other models employ camera-based navigation systems, which utilize the built-in optical camera in order to create a map. These systems might not be able recognize objects in dim lighting. Additionally, there are robots with LiDAR and camera-based navigation systems.
